What is NCHM JEE 2025?

The NCHM JEE (National Council for Hotel Management Joint Entrance Examination) is a national-level entrance test conducted by the NTA for admission to B.Sc. (Hospitality & Hotel Administration) programs offered by NCHMCT-affiliated institutes, including IHMs (Institutes of Hotel Management) across India.

This exam is the gateway for students who aspire to pursue a career in the hospitality, tourism, and hotel management sectors. Successful candidates gain access to some of the most reputed institutes offering cutting-edge curriculum, industry internships, and placement opportunities in India and abroad.

NCHM JEE 2025 Exam Pattern

Understanding the exam format is crucial for success. Here’s a quick overview:

SectionNo. of QuestionsMarks
Numerical Ability & Analytical Aptitude30120
Reasoning & Logical Deduction30120
General Knowledge & Current Affairs30120
English Language60240
Aptitude for Service Sector50200
Total200800

Each question carries 4 marks, and 1 mark is deducted for each wrong answer, except for the Aptitude for Service Sector section which uses a graded marking system.

FAQs On NCHM JEE 2025 Admit Card

Q1: Can I show the admit card on my phone?

No. Only a printed copy of the admit card is accepted at the exam centre.

Q2: What if I forget to bring my photo ID?

You will not be allowed to appear for the exam. Carry valid ID without fail.

Q3: Can I change my exam centre after admit card is released?

No, the exam centre once allotted cannot be changed.

Q4: What should I do if there’s a spelling mistake in my name on the admit card?

Contact NTA support immediately at [email protected] for correction guidance.

Q5: Will the admit card be sent via post?

No. Admit cards are available only online. NTA does not send physical copies.
